cburn009 02-10-2011 10:48 AM

I dont know if you sucked a gasket, but you definately are running richer than normal. I had similar issues with this on my 03. I pulled the intake manifold off and tested the injectors to see if one was possibly stuck open, all were fine and tested with the correct resistance. I then decided to change the fuel filter and since it had not been done in ages and it ran perfectly. I would also verify that you do not have any vacuum leaks as this could cause your engine to think its running lean and dump more fuel to compensate for the leak. I would investigate these things before throwing too much money into ripping the head off.
